[06] SIGNATURE WEAPONRY

PI Planning Board (digital or physical)
A visual representation of 'commitment' to an unrealistic 2-3 month forecast, often populated with pre-determined objectives.
Weighted Shortest Job First (WSJF)
A 'scientific' prioritization algorithm used to justify decisions already made, often leading to a complete absence of a discovery process.
Program Predictability Measure
A metric to quantify how accurately teams hit their pre-ordained, often arbitrary, PI objectives, regardless of market changes or learning.

[10] THE BURN WARD (UNFILTERED COMPLAINTS)

* The stark reality of the role, scraped from Reddit, Blind, and anonymous career boards.
"Even what SAFe describes is, in my opinion (and that of many others) anti-agile."
"There is money in SAFe as companies try to make it work, but developers hate it and management is not seeing the benefits promised."
"Of course 90% of all prep work (scenarios, requirements, user research) happened outside of the safe train work and started 1-2 quarters in advance and most of decisions have already been made prior to these sessions."
"The biggest pitfalls of SAFe is the complete absence of a discovery process + the PI increment means you have to have designs completely 100% ready for WSJF at least a fortnight before the 12 week PI (PI n) and the designs can only be worked on with dev in the PI leading up to that (PI n-1) and so your product research tends to be taking place the one before that (PI n-2)."
